Filename, size file type python version upload date hashes. Using angularjs to build dynamic web pages with sqlite apache spark. When purchasing a subscription, you immediately get a perpetual license for the version available at the time of the subscription expiration the subscriptionbased model provides the following advantages. Net from a sql server, microsoft access, mysql or sqlite database design. But thereafter, the code is the same so it will work equally on a local sqlite database, and on a database on my server at 192. It is selfcontained, serverless, zeroconfiguration and transactional. Trigger sqlite ifttt flows in azure app service coldfusion. The second method is to set up an odbc driver for sqlite and then use the database tool.
In this example, we first create a connection object that opens the sqlite database. Crudsqlitethe program, for standard database queries, select, update, insert, delete. If youre not sure which to choose, learn more about installing packages. Aug 29, 2016 the interactive transcript could not be loaded. After a couple hours of poking around and googling theres hours of my life im not getting back. The connection name must be passed to adddatabase at connection object create time. To create a new database file, specify a file name that does not exist on your hard drive. I have been successful in using them separately but ibhave yet to might a tutorial that explains using all three well. You can search for your database name in windows if you dont know where its store. Is it possible to import the spiceworks db or any sqlite db into ms sql server so that i may use the microsoft sql server management studio. Our drivers make integration a snap, providing an easytouse relational interface for working with sqlite data. But if the host computer crashes in the middle of a commit where two or more database files are updated, some of those files might get the changes where others might not. I know that this question was discussed many times, but im still cant resolve situation, will appreciate any help.
I was wondering what the best method is for transfer data from a qtablewidget to an sqlite database and if im on the right try if you could help me find a way to generate some sql code. I saw in other threads the same problem, but there it had been solved or at least it seems so by reading them simply installing the libqt4 sql mysql package there were dependency problems to solve or simply the package was not installed at all. For the qoci oracle driver, the database name is the tns service name. Though i have tested the sqlite jdbc driver on win with a mapped network drive.
The stability of that mode of operation is questionable, as can be searched on this forums discussions. How to create student database management system using sqlite in python. Complete overview creating a database, table, and running queries duration. I have already added sql sqlite to packageconfig from within confnf by. Bug listing with status resolved with resolution upstream as at. The filename for the database to be attached is the value of the expression that occurs before the as keyword. To set up an automatic backup task for your sqlite data, please follow the next instruction before starting, check for an odbc driver corresponding to your sqlite database. A database very rarely stays the same once it been created data is added, deleted and sometime changed. Aplicacion grafica con pyqt4 y sqlite3 en python mi. Doesnt anybody have any material in getting sqlite, python, and pyqt all integrated together.
Driver not loaded qsqlite i have the sqlite file in usrinclude and usrlib and looked for an answer but most of all came from driver which were not available and mine seems to be ok, mysql driver, on windows and on qt so i didnt succed to solve it by looking the net. Select sqlite3 odbc driver from the list and click finish. This comprises the classes qsqldriver, qsqldrivercreatorbase, and qsqlresult. Native mysql client not requiring any special driver or library. Python, sqlite, and pyqt doesnt anybody have any material in getting sqlite, python, and pyqt all integrated together. Download dbexpress driver for sqlite dbexpress driver 4. Pyqt database driver loading issues on windows after. Bug listing with status resolved with resolution needinfo as at. By looking to much i skipped the begin i passed too quickly to the driver part in. Driver not loaded when trying to access database in pyqt stack. I have the sqlite file in usrinclude and usrlib and looked for an answer but.
I suspect people here may know the answer regarding any ports the odbc driver uses, but you may be better off asking the maintainer of the odbc driver. Some applications can use sqlite for internal data storage. Jan 24, 20 however, the pyside database examples ran fine, so looks like installing pyside messed something up in the pyqt installation. Following is the list of currently available sql drivers. If the database file is not found, the driver will create a new blank database.
I am trying to create a mysql database using pyqt5 on python 3. A connection with a sqlite database is established using the static method. The driver is usable but may contain lots of memory leaks and all other kinds of bugs. Both methods can provide effective sqlite backup and restore.
Its qsqldatabase provides access through a connection object. I dont have any sqldrivers folder inside my pyqt5 folder jb tand jul 19 18 at 16. Qsqlite driver not loaded showing 16 of 6 messages. Hi, am trying to open a firewall to the machine having sqlite database. I want to build it in sql, but the tools to query sqlite are not near as advanced as the tools to query ms sql server. Once we have a connection object associated with the database, we can create a cursor object. It is very fast and lightweight, and the entire database is stored in a single disk file. Rapidly develop sqlite driven apps with active query builder angular js. Driver not loaded when trying to access database in pyqt. Now there are wrappers around sqlite to extend it, i assume this odbc driver is one of them. How to backup sqlite database with handy backup here we are describing how to make a sqlite backup using the common computer data source. Mysql sql database entry points for sqlite data the cdata odbc drivers include powerful fullyintegrated remote access capabilities that makes sqlite data accessible from virtually anywhere.
Qsqlquery class has the functionality to execute and. Please read the qt sql driver documentation for information how to build it. Work with sqlite in apache spark using sql microsoft azure logic apps. The dbexpress driver architecture is used by codegear development environments. For the qodbc driver, the name can either be a dsn, a dsn filename in which case the file must have a. Now enter a name for your db and click on the browser button and point to your sqlite database file. Click on the add button and select the sqlite3 odbc driver and click on finish. Otherwise, python creates a new database in the test. We are recommending you using the first method usually, and turning to odbc configuration when you wish to set up a multisource backup task processing many different databases. Unfortunately it pops error driver not loaded, you could say there is no dll for the driver, the fun part is that qsqldatabasedrivers. Mysqlsql database entry points for sqlite data the cdata odbc drivers include powerful fullyintegrated remote access capabilities that makes sqlite data accessible from virtually anywhere. I am making a program to keep track of current projects or my company and i have a gui with a table that a user will add data too. The drivers include the cdata sql gateway, which can the optional ability to accept incoming sql and mysql client connections and service standard.
Jun 25, 2017 crud sqlite the program, for standard database queries, select, update, insert, delete. The sqlite drivers are now included with python distributions. Pyqt api contains an elaborate class system to communicate with many sql based databases. Source code for the sqlite example and for the mysql example. The next screen allows you to specify a name for this dns and the path for your database. From your description and the code above, it sounds like qt is dynamically loading database drivers this language implies to me that they are loaded dynamically which would mean that py2exe cant detect that theyre needed. Sqlite is a small footprint fast sql database engine designed for single user computers. Database files that were previously attached can be removed using the detach database command.
This layer provides the lowlevel bridge between the specific databases and the sql api layer. However, the pyside database examples ran fine, so looks like installing pyside messed something up in the pyqt installation. You can search for your database name in windows if you dont know where its. Display microsoft sql server query result with pyqt5 in. Sqlite odbc driver this is an open source odbc driver for the wonderful sqlite 2. The cursor object enables us to run the execute method, which in turn enables us to run raw sql statements such as create table, select, et cetera.
I have already added sqlsqlite to packageconfig from within confnf by. The attach database statement adds another database file to the current database connection. Once we have a connection object associated with the database, we can create a. So the environment wasnt the probleme but my code is. You may not remember next time either, so install grepper. Access sqlite databases from bi, analytics, and reporting tools, through easytouse bidirectional data drivers.
117 1351 972 530 448 1384 904 877 976 390 877 662 1422 1516 1261 986 1065 1038 1012 805 1381 563 308 1089 1530 278 592 999 884 598 201 345 1030 118 766 449 590 226 846 1348 731